City Lit offers performing arts courses in the heart of Covent Garden in Central London during the evening, daytime and at weekends. Explore our range of subjects including acting, (including accredited acting courses), dance, radio and screen, and voice, speech and communication as well as a full range of music courses, such as piano, singing, strings and wind instruments to jazz and pop, music technology, music theory and history
Our courses are labelled clearly for beginners or those with previous experience and you can speak to a specialist advisor to help you choose the right level. If you would you like some help or advice:
